编程能编到什么程度的程序

不及物动词 其他 15

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程能力的发展程度是一个相对的概念,取决于个人的学习能力、经验积累和专业背景。编程能力可以分为初级、中级和高级三个层次。

    初级编程能力是指掌握基本的编程语法和常用的算法,能够实现简单的程序功能。初级程序员可以编写一些简单的小工具或者简单的网页应用,但是对于复杂的问题可能需要借助搜索引擎或者请教他人。

    中级编程能力是在初级的基础上进一步提升,能够独立完成中等难度的软件开发任务。中级程序员具备良好的编程习惯和代码结构能力,能够熟练运用各种编程工具和框架,能够进行软件设计、数据库开发和系统调优等工作。

    高级编程能力是指在中级的基础上达到更高的水平,具备深入理解计算机原理和算法的能力。高级程序员能够解决复杂的技术问题,能够进行系统级的开发和架构设计,能够优化和调试性能问题,同时也能够指导和培养初级和中级程序员。

    除了以上的层次之外,还有一些特殊领域的专业编程能力,例如嵌入式系统开发、人工智能和大数据分析等。这些领域需要更深入的专业知识和技术掌握。

    总的来说,编程能力的发展程度是一个渐进的过程,需要不断地学习和实践。通过不断地提升自己的技术水平,不断地探索新的编程领域,我们可以不断地提高自己的编程能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程的能力可以达到很高的程度,具体取决于个人的学习和实践经验。以下是编程能力可以达到的不同程度的程序:

    1. 低级程度的程序:这是编程的入门阶段,包括了基本的语法和逻辑结构。这种程序可以完成简单的任务,如打印输出、基本计算和简单的数据处理。这些程序通常是一些简单的脚本或小型应用程序。

    2. 中级程度的程序:在这个阶段,程序员已经掌握了更复杂的语法和算法。他们可以编写一些较大规模的应用程序,包括图形界面、网络通信和数据库操作等功能。这些程序可能涉及到更复杂的数据结构和算法,需要更多的编程技巧和经验。

    3. 高级程度的程序:在这个阶段,程序员已经具备了深入的编程知识和经验。他们可以编写复杂的应用程序,如操作系统、数据库管理系统和人工智能系统等。这些程序需要深入了解底层原理和算法,并能够进行高效的性能优化和调试。

    4. 专家级程度的程序:这个阶段的程序员已经成为某个领域的专家,他们对特定的编程语言、框架或领域有深入的了解。他们可以设计和开发复杂的系统,并解决各种复杂的技术问题。他们通常会参与到一些大型项目或研究中,对编程的应用有深入的理解和创新。

    5. 极限程度的程序:这是极少数程序员达到的顶级水平。他们在编程领域有着极高的造诣和创造力,能够解决一些极其复杂和困难的问题。他们可能会参与到一些前沿的研究项目中,对编程语言、编译器、虚拟机等底层技术有深入的了解。

    总之,编程的能力可以达到不同的程度,从简单的脚本到复杂的系统,再到顶级的创新和研究。这需要不断的学习和实践,以及对编程领域的深入了解和热情。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程能力的水平可以从初级到高级不等,具体取决于个人的学习和实践经验。下面是一些常见的编程能力水平:

    初级水平:
    在初级水平上,编程者通常具备以下能力:

    1. 理解基本的编程概念,如变量、数据类型、条件语句、循环和函数等。
    2. 能够使用一种编程语言编写简单的程序,如打印"Hello, World!"、计算两个数的和等。
    3. 理解简单的算法和数据结构,如线性搜索、冒泡排序等。
    4. 能够通过调试来解决一些简单的编程错误。

    中级水平:
    在中级水平上,编程者通常具备以下能力:

    1. 熟练掌握一种或多种编程语言,并能够使用其高级特性编写复杂的程序。
    2. 理解并能够使用常见的算法和数据结构,如二分查找、快速排序等。
    3. 能够设计和实现简单的软件系统,如网站、应用程序等。
    4. 具备良好的编码习惯,能够编写易于理解和维护的代码。
    5. 能够使用调试工具和技术来解决复杂的编程错误。

    高级水平:
    在高级水平上,编程者通常具备以下能力:

    1. 深入理解计算机科学的各个领域,如操作系统、数据库、网络等。
    2. 能够设计和实现复杂的软件系统,如大型网站、分布式系统等。
    3. 熟练运用各种编程工具和框架,能够提高开发效率和代码质量。
    4. 具备良好的软件工程实践,如代码重用、模块化设计等。
    5. 能够进行性能优化和调优,提高程序的效率和响应速度。
    6. 能够通过代码审查和测试来确保软件质量。

    总结:
    编程能力的水平可以从初级到高级不等,每个水平都有不同的学习和实践要求。通过不断学习和实践,可以提升自己的编程能力,并不断进阶到更高的水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部